Application du protocole de preuve de brûlage dans l'écosystème Cardano
Récemment, l'équipe Iagon a réussi à développer un protocole de preuve de combustion (PoB) adapté à l'écosystème Cardano. Ce protocole vise à résoudre les problèmes soulevés par Charles Hoskinson. Cet article présentera en détail cette solution innovante.
Aperçu du mécanisme de preuve de brûlage
La preuve de brûlage consiste essentiellement à envoyer des jetons à une adresse "trou noir" inaccessible. Ce mécanisme a plusieurs usages, tant pour augmenter la valeur des jetons restants que comme preuve d'engagement du protocole de blockchain. Bien que brûler une grande quantité de jetons puisse créer une pression déflationniste, Iagon s'engage à développer un protocole de brûlage de jetons irrévocable.
La sécurité de la preuve de brûlage est basée sur des fonctions de hachage cryptographique. Ces fonctions sont faciles à calculer, mais difficiles à inverser, garantissant ainsi la sécurité des transactions. En inversant le bit le moins significatif de la sortie de la fonction de hachage cryptographique, il est possible de créer une adresse de trou noir. Tout ce qui est envoyé à cette adresse sera difficile ou impossible à récupérer.
Mécanisme de preuve de brûlage dans les contrats intelligents Cardano
Les contrats intelligents Cardano se composent de trois parties :
Script de rachat : contrôle des dépenses des eUTxOs
Script de portefeuille : représente l'utilisateur en cours d'exécution, utilisé pour récupérer des fonds et créer de nouveaux eUTxOs
eUTxOs : détenir des fonds et des points de données ( datum )
Le mécanisme de preuve de brûlure dans les contrats intelligents Cardano comprend quatre opérations possibles :
Brûlage : envoyer des fonds à l'adresse du trou noir
Vérification : confirmer qu'une combustion de la valeur d'engagement a eu lieu
Verrouillage : envoyer des fonds à une adresse avec une clé
Rachat : récupérer des fonds bloqués
Déploiement des contrats intelligents
Pour déployer un contrat intelligent sur le réseau de test, vous devez suivre les étapes suivantes:
Installer la chaîne d'outils Haskell
Construire un script Plutus
Démarrer le conteneur de nœud et de portefeuille Cardano
Récupérer le portefeuille et obtenir l'ID du portefeuille
Exécution de la brûlure de jetons
Vérifier les résultats de combustion
Des contrats intelligents aux scripts de portefeuille
Pour améliorer davantage la sécurité et la résistance à la censure, Iagon a proposé un schéma n'utilisant que des scripts de portefeuille. Cette méthode peut empêcher le blocage sélectif des transactions de brûlage, rendant la censure plus difficile.
Pour réaliser cela, il est nécessaire de remplacer le hachage de la clé publique par le hachage de la valeur d'engagement et de retourner le bit le moins significatif de la valeur d'engagement. De plus, il est également nécessaire d'utiliser la bibliothèque API Cardano pour générer une adresse de combustion conforme à la structure d'adresse Cardano et à la vérification CRC.
Résumé
Le protocole de preuve de brûlure développé par Iagon offre une solution innovante pour l'écosystème Cardano. Bien qu'il soit actuellement recommandé d'utiliser des scripts de portefeuille, avec la mise en œuvre de la bibliothèque PAB, des solutions de contrats intelligents plus complexes pourraient émerger à l'avenir, renforçant ainsi la résistance à la censure. Le développement de cette technologie apportera davantage de possibilités à l'écosystème Cardano.
Cette page peut inclure du contenu de tiers fourni à des fins d'information uniquement. Gate ne garantit ni l'exactitude ni la validité de ces contenus, n’endosse pas les opinions exprimées, et ne fournit aucun conseil financier ou professionnel à travers ces informations. Voir la section Avertissement pour plus de détails.
Innovation majeure dans l'écosystème Cardano : Iagon développe un protocole de preuve de brûlure anti-censure.
Application du protocole de preuve de brûlage dans l'écosystème Cardano
Récemment, l'équipe Iagon a réussi à développer un protocole de preuve de combustion (PoB) adapté à l'écosystème Cardano. Ce protocole vise à résoudre les problèmes soulevés par Charles Hoskinson. Cet article présentera en détail cette solution innovante.
Aperçu du mécanisme de preuve de brûlage
La preuve de brûlage consiste essentiellement à envoyer des jetons à une adresse "trou noir" inaccessible. Ce mécanisme a plusieurs usages, tant pour augmenter la valeur des jetons restants que comme preuve d'engagement du protocole de blockchain. Bien que brûler une grande quantité de jetons puisse créer une pression déflationniste, Iagon s'engage à développer un protocole de brûlage de jetons irrévocable.
La sécurité de la preuve de brûlage est basée sur des fonctions de hachage cryptographique. Ces fonctions sont faciles à calculer, mais difficiles à inverser, garantissant ainsi la sécurité des transactions. En inversant le bit le moins significatif de la sortie de la fonction de hachage cryptographique, il est possible de créer une adresse de trou noir. Tout ce qui est envoyé à cette adresse sera difficile ou impossible à récupérer.
Mécanisme de preuve de brûlage dans les contrats intelligents Cardano
Les contrats intelligents Cardano se composent de trois parties :
Le mécanisme de preuve de brûlure dans les contrats intelligents Cardano comprend quatre opérations possibles :
Déploiement des contrats intelligents
Pour déployer un contrat intelligent sur le réseau de test, vous devez suivre les étapes suivantes:
Des contrats intelligents aux scripts de portefeuille
Pour améliorer davantage la sécurité et la résistance à la censure, Iagon a proposé un schéma n'utilisant que des scripts de portefeuille. Cette méthode peut empêcher le blocage sélectif des transactions de brûlage, rendant la censure plus difficile.
Pour réaliser cela, il est nécessaire de remplacer le hachage de la clé publique par le hachage de la valeur d'engagement et de retourner le bit le moins significatif de la valeur d'engagement. De plus, il est également nécessaire d'utiliser la bibliothèque API Cardano pour générer une adresse de combustion conforme à la structure d'adresse Cardano et à la vérification CRC.
Résumé
Le protocole de preuve de brûlure développé par Iagon offre une solution innovante pour l'écosystème Cardano. Bien qu'il soit actuellement recommandé d'utiliser des scripts de portefeuille, avec la mise en œuvre de la bibliothèque PAB, des solutions de contrats intelligents plus complexes pourraient émerger à l'avenir, renforçant ainsi la résistance à la censure. Le développement de cette technologie apportera davantage de possibilités à l'écosystème Cardano.